Narcotic as a Noun has these synonyms:
drug, soporific, stuporific, hypnotic, sedative, opiate, anaesthetic, stupefacient, tranquillizerExample: Many doctors are reluctant to prescribe narcotics.
soporific, stuporific, hypnotic, sedative, somnolent, sleep-inducing, opiate, dulling, numbing, anaesthetic, stupefacient, stupefying, stupefactive, tranquillizing
Example: Most narcotic drugs may be sold only with a doctor's prescription.
